Product Description: When Crocodile visits the dentist, both are fearful of the experience, in a humorous, colorfully illustrated story in which everyone ends up intact and regular dental care is encouraged.
Amazon.com Review: Ages 3-8. Many people fear going to the dentist, but as this ingenious book shows, sometimes it can be just as scary on the other side of the chair. As a crocodile walks to the dentist's office, he thinks, "I really don't want to see him...but I must." Oddly enough, the dentist is thinking the exact same thing about him! The clever text continues in this manner, getting funnier with each duplicated thought, as both characters struggle to be brave and remain polite. An American Booksellers Assoc. "Pick of the Lists."
A Painful Hit For most adults The Crocodile & The Dentist is likely to appear excruciatingly repetitive. This impression is not alleviated after 60 or 70 readings. In other words, it is a delight for 2 and 3 year olds, probably because of its repetitiveness. Youngsters will know by heart the story of the crocodile and dentist's mutual fear of one another long before they weary of hearing it read aloud.
